Icnode.com

IC's Troubleshooting & Solutions

XC7A100T-2FGG484C Not Recognized_ USB-PC Interface Issues

XC7A100T-2FGG484C Not Recognized: USB-PC interface Issues

Fault Analysis: " XC7A100T-2FGG484C Not Recognized: USB/PC Interface Issues"

When you're dealing with the XC7A100T-2FGG484C not being recognized via the USB or PC interface, there are several possible reasons behind the issue. This kind of problem typically involves a few key areas: hardware configuration, driver issues, and communication setup. Let’s break down the potential causes and step-by-step solutions in a simple and clear manner.

Possible Causes of the Issue:

Incorrect USB Driver Installation: If the USB Drivers for the device are not properly installed or are out of date, your PC may not recognize the XC7A100T-2FGG484C.

Power Supply or USB Cable Issue: Sometimes the issue could simply be a faulty USB cable or an insufficient power supply that prevents the device from establishing proper communication with the PC.

Device or Configuration Error: The FPGA configuration might not be correct, or the USB interface on the FPGA might not be properly configured to connect to the PC.

PC USB Port Compatibility: Some USB ports on PCs (especially older ones) may have compatibility issues with the device, or they may not provide sufficient power for the FPGA to function properly.

Software or Firmware Problems: The software or firmware needed to recognize the device might be corrupted or incompatible with the system.

Step-by-Step Solutions:

Step 1: Verify Hardware Connections Check the USB Cable: Ensure the USB cable is firmly connected and is not damaged. Try using a different cable to rule out a defective one. Test with Another USB Port: Connect the device to a different USB port on your PC, preferably a USB 3.0 or 3.1 port for better data transfer speeds. Confirm Power Supply: If the device requires an external power supply, make sure it's properly connected and providing the correct voltage. Some USB ports may not provide enough power. Step 2: Install or Update USB Drivers

Install the Latest USB Drivers: Make sure the USB drivers for the XC7A100T-2FGG484C are installed correctly. You can download these drivers from the manufacturer's website or use the CD that came with the device.

If you already have the drivers, try uninstalling and reinstalling them to ensure there are no corrupt files.

Check if your PC's operating system requires any specific driver updates.

Update the FPGA Programming Software: Sometimes the software used to configure and interact with the FPGA needs an update. Ensure you are using the latest version of the software that is compatible with your operating system.

Step 3: Check Device Manager and PC Settings Device Manager Check (Windows): Go to "Device Manager" and check if the device is listed under "Universal Serial Bus Controllers ." If there is a yellow exclamation mark next to it, that indicates a driver issue. Right-click on the device and select “Update Driver.” Reboot the PC: After installing drivers or making any changes, reboot your computer to ensure that the changes take effect. Step 4: FPGA Configuration Settings Check FPGA Configuration: Double-check that the FPGA is properly configured for USB communication. If you have custom configuration files, ensure they are correctly loaded. Check JTAG or USB Interface Settings: Some FPGAs use JTAG or USB-Blaster interfaces for programming. Make sure the settings in your software match the interface you're using. Step 5: Testing the Device on Another PC Test on Another Computer: If the device still isn’t recognized on your PC, try connecting it to another computer to rule out any PC-specific issues (e.g., a problem with the USB ports on your PC). Step 6: Check for Software/Firmware Updates Update FPGA Firmware: If your device firmware is outdated, you may need to update it. Visit the manufacturer's website for the latest firmware releases. Check for Software Compatibility: Ensure that the software you're using to communicate with the FPGA is compatible with the version of the device you have. Step 7: Reset the Device Factory Reset: If none of the above solutions work, try performing a factory reset on the device (if applicable). This can sometimes resolve issues caused by incorrect configurations or corrupted settings.

Conclusion:

By systematically checking each of these potential issues, you can typically resolve the problem of the XC7A100T-2FGG484C not being recognized via the USB/PC interface. Start with simple things like checking the cables and USB ports, then move to driver and software configurations if necessary. If everything else fails, testing the device on another computer or performing a firmware update might be your final solution.

Keep in mind that patience and a methodical approach are key to troubleshooting these types of interface issues.

Add comment:

◎Welcome to take comment to discuss this post.

«    August , 2025    »
Mon Tue Wed Thu Fri Sat Sun
123
45678910
11121314151617
18192021222324
25262728293031
Categories
Search
Recent Comments
    Archives
    Links

    Powered By Icnode.com

    Copyright Icnode.com Rights Reserved.